Title: The Horadric Cube of the Mind
Marcus had spent twenty years chasing the same white whale: a perfect Zod rune. Not for trade, not for ladder glory—just for the quiet satisfaction of socketing it into a ethereal Berserker Axe on his own single-player sorceress.
When Diablo II: Resurrected dropped, his wife bought it for him as a joke-anniversary gift. "You can finally beat Baal on /players 8," she teased. Marcus smiled. He had already beaten Baal thousands of times. What he wanted now was control.
That’s when he found the trainer—a small, third-party executable called "Hero Editor Reborn (Offline Only)." No bans. No judgment. Just a slider for experience, a checkbox for "Unlimited Skill Points," and a field to spawn any item code.
At first, it felt like cheating on a diet. He gave his Paladin a level 99 aura. He gave his Necromancer 50 skeletons. He laughed as Duriel melted in two seconds. But then something shifted.
The trainer became less about breaking the game and more about rewriting his evening. After long workdays, he’d boot up D2R offline, load his modded save, and build absurd theme characters: a throwing-barbarian who only used exploding potions, a bow-mancer with maxed Confuse and a Windforce. The trainer turned Sanctuary into his personal LEGO set.
His friend Leah called it "dad gaming." No stress. No meta. Just a cold beer, a mechanical keyboard, and the freedom to turn Mephisto into a loot piñata with a single right-click.
One night, his daughter wandered in. "What are you playing?"
"Diablo," he said, showing her his sorceress—who now shot frozen orbs like a machine gun.
"That looks broken."
Marcus smiled. "That’s the point. It’s my little sandbox. Work was hard today. This… this is my therapy."
She watched him clear the Chaos Sanctuary in thirty seconds, then asked to try. He handed her the mouse. She made a druid and summoned forty wolves. They both laughed.
The trainer wasn't ruining the game. It was rescuing his free time—one overpowered hero at a time.

D2R includes several built-in features for offline play that function like cheats: Infinite Respecs -enablerespec to the game's launch arguments in the Battle.net client or shortcut. In-game, hold and click a stat point plus sign to reset everything. Difficulty Scaling /players 8
in the chat box to simulate an 8-player game. This makes enemies harder but drastically increases experience and loot drops. Character Editing Online Hero Editor to modify your diablo 2 resurrected trainer offline hot
save file. You can inject specific items, change levels, or complete quests instantly. Important Safety Tips Offline Only
: Never launch these tools while connected to Battle.net. Most trainers will automatically disable themselves or warn you, but manually ensuring you are in Offline Mode is the safest practice. Save Backups : Always backup your save files located at %userprofile%\Saved Games\Diablo II Resurrected
before using a trainer, as they can occasionally corrupt character data. for infinite respecs?

Trainers are typically external programs that run alongside the game to modify live memory values (e.g., infinite health) or static save files (e.g., editing inventory). 1. Popular Trainer Tools WeMod Trainer
: A popular, user-friendly application that automatically detects your game version. It currently supports options such as Super Health Super Mana , and editing Stat/Skill Points StopGame +25 Trainer
: An extensive trainer for version v2.1.6 offering deep customization, including modifying character class, state, starting act, and inventory properties like upgrading gems to perfect status. DrummerIX Trainer
: Offers standard cheats like unlimited stamina and health, as well as direct editing of vitality, energy, and strength. 2. Hero Editors & Mod Tools Unlike live trainers, these tools modify your save file while the game is closed. d2runewizard.com
: A web-based editor that allows you to create characters from scratch, test builds, and generate any rune words. D2EonWizard
: A tool for creating high-level characters, adding specific items, and unlocking quests in single-player mode. 3. Built-in Offline "Cheats"
